Colors


AED uses Duke’s approved brand colors.

PRIMARY BRAND COLORS

The official Duke blue is a shade of navy blue that has been in use for decades. Called “Duke Navy Blue”  in our palette, it is sometimes referred to as “Academic Blue.”

“Duke Royal Blue”   is the other shade of blue in the palette and has been in use since 2009 for athletics, apparel and promotional materials.

Both shades of blue represent the Duke brand and at least one of them should be used somewhere in any project. Any adjustment to the opacity or saturation of these colors is prohibited, and projects must adhere to accessibility standard regarding contrast ratios with these colors.

 

Duke Navy Blue

PMS 280 U / C
HEX #012169
RGB 1, 33, 105
CMYK 100, 85, 5, 22

Duke Royal Blue

PMS 287 U / C
HEX #00539B
RGB 0, 83, 155
CMYK 100, 53, 2, 16

COLOR ACCESSIBILITY

For accessibility reasons, we may darken or increase the contrast of certain colors. AED aims for a level AAA rating of color accessibility, per W3C’s Web Content Accessibility Guidelines 2.0. You can test your color accessibility through the WebAIM Color Contrast Checker.

You can also use Duke’s Color Accessibility Guide to identify color combinations that are compliant and Accessible Colors to offer suggestions on other text or background colors.
